Abstract
A system for managing the operation of a plurality of radio modules integrated within the same wireless communication device. In at least one embodiment of the present invention, time may be allocated for use in communicating over one or more wireless communication mediums. This time may be allocated based on a determination that a maximum power usage threshold will not be exceeded, and that potential communication conflicts may be avoided, over a period of time. The allocation may result in an operational schedule that may be utilized by radio modules in the wireless communication device that support the one or more wireless communication mediums.
